About Delta Controls Inc.
Delta Controls is the benchmark for building controls manufacturers, being one of the most respected organizations in our industry, with more than 300 Partners/Distributors in over 80 countries. For more than three decades Delta Controls has offered innovative and exciting building automation solutions for commercial, healthcare, education, leisure buildings and more. As industry leaders, our track record includes delivering the world’s first fully integrated native BACnet building solution encompassing HVAC, lighting and access control products.
As part of Delta Electronics Inc., the global leader in switching power supply solutions and DC brushless fans and an $8+ billion USD organization, Delta Controls is able to bring some of the most energy efficient and sustainable solutions to buildings around the world, working together toward our shared vision of developing technologies aimed at reducing global warming and ensuring a sustainable future for mankind. Delta Electronics products are the most energy efficient power products in the industry and include a comprehensive range of energy management solutions in Industrial Automation, Telecom Power, UPS and Data Center Infrastructure, Automotive Electronics and Energy Storage Systems.

Duties and Responsibilities
- Work with customers, product managers and other stakeholders to discover, analyze and document use-cases for products
- Help create design guidelines, create component libraries, and manage them in Figma
- Develop and deliver high-level and detailed storyboards, information architecture, workflow diagrams, user interface sketches, mock-ups, prototypes, images and icons, and detailed design specifications
- Communicate and document design concepts as well as specifications to the development team
- Create user personas, user scenarios, and develop concept models
- Participate in the planning and execution of user testing, AB testing, as well as the analysis and reporting of test results during different project phases
- Support development teams as they deliver products that implement your designs
- Design for a variety of platforms including cloud/web-based and mobile-interface
- Participate in software development lifecycle using agile development techniques like daily stand-up, sprint planning, task estimation and development, and sprint reviews and retrospectives
- Stay current with new UI/UX technologies, designing platforms, and evolving solutions
